"Good location, generally pretty good, friendly."
Its in a decent location, handy for the west end and shopping/museaums. Its generally quite friendly, not too formal.
Rooms do vary. I've had two doubles ranging from very nice modern decor, to homely slightly worn (but acceptable). Decent beds in both cases.
Breakfast is a very pricey, i'm not sure it's worth the £15 or so! You have to queue up for a small table and we didn't get any tea (despite asking many many times) the last time.
However, i'd happily go back there, so that says something.
ALSO - plenty of free Wi-fi access floating around when i was there.

"Lovely room, good breakfast"
Spent 2 nights here on business. Have to say this is the best mid range hotel I've stayed in in London. The room was spacious, 2 double beds, lots of light (I did have a corner room. 232). Decorated in a very modern style but sympathetic to the age of the hotel. Bathroom very smart with quality fittings. Hotel populated by business people rather than tourists which seems to keep the standards up as I have stayed in some London Hotels which are full of coach parties and the hotels seem to treat them like cattle!
The breakfast was buffet style and of very good quality, nothing fancy , just the usual fare but cooked and presented well.
Yes the public areas are a sea of garish marble and the layout is a bit odd but it is an old victorian hotel and it would be a crime to rip out all that history and replace it with glass and steel. I have to say being a scotsman and £3.20 for a pint in the bar was a painful!! Lots of places to eat and drink round about, after all that's the beauty of London.

Great stay at the Russell Hotel
We had a fantastic weekend in London and our stay at the Russell Hotel was just great. The rooms are rather on the small side but nicely furnished and bathroom very modern. Ask for a room on the 2nd or 3rd floor, they have been renovated so no bad suprises there. Breakfast was ok, which means not too much choice of cold cuts and cheese. I will certainly stay there again. Very helpful staff memebers and great location. |
